I got into crypto in 2014 with no finance background — no degree, no Bloomberg terminal, no mentor. Just a laptop, a Coinbase account that barely worked, and a habit of reading everything I could find. Most of what I learned came from losing money on things I should have researched first.
I traded through the 2017 run-up and the 80% crash that followed. I watched FTX collapse in real time — I had been watching the warning signs for weeks. I've paid fees on exchanges I didn't need to use, held positions too long, and made every classic mistake at least once.
In 2023, I retired. I live off dividend income from yield ETFs — YieldMax, Roundhill, Defiance. That's the actual outcome of 10 years of doing this. CryptoRyancy is what I built along the way to help people skip the expensive part of the learning curve.
No credentials. No hype. No paywall. Just what I actually know.
